Anglo American Zimele, in partnership with Sigma International, is rolling out a tourism business incubator for existing tourism businesses located within Anglo’s host communities of Anglo American Platinum. The tourism business incubator will provide needs-based business development and operational support interventions, over a period of up to 12-month period.

On Friday, 14 June 2024 just before dark, rangers made contact with a group of suspected rhino poachers who were armed with a high calibre rifle, an axe and other poaching equipment. One of the suspects was fatally wounded on contact while the others escaped. A rifle and ammunition were recovered at the scene.

The City of Cape Town is making steady progress with the rehabilitation of Tafelberg Road. Work commenced in February this year and to date, up to 85% of the stormwater infrastructure along this road has been replaced, improved, and rehabilitated. Table Mountain Aerial Cableway Company (TMACC) has transported millions of people to the summit of Table Mountain since it first started operating in 1929. The Cableway itself is regarded as a feat of engineering. It adheres to the most stringent international standards, such as the Swiss BAV regulations for cableways.
